From: Ian Jackson Date: Fri, 29 Jan 2021 22:54:35 +0000 (+0000) Subject: wdt: remove some silly lifetime annotations nfc X-Git-Tag: otter-0.4.0~635 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=ba013b36c77dd4db39b3563c785d8edeb5323f07;p=otter.git wdt: remove some silly lifetime annotations nfc Signed-off-by: Ian Jackson --- diff --git a/wdriver.rs b/wdriver.rs index ad800b14..c904cdb7 100644 --- a/wdriver.rs +++ b/wdriver.rs @@ -802,7 +802,7 @@ impl<'g> WindowGuard<'g> { } #[throws(AE)] - pub fn piece_held(&'g self, pc: &'g str) -> Option { + pub fn piece_held(&self, pc: &str) -> Option { let held = self.execute_script(&format!(r##" let pc = pieces['{}']; return pc.held; @@ -817,7 +817,7 @@ impl<'g> WindowGuard<'g> { } #[throws(AE)] - pub fn posg2posw(&'g self, posg: Pos) -> WebPos { + pub fn posg2posw(&self, posg: Pos) -> WebPos { let mat = self.matrix.get_or_try_init(||{ let ary = self.su.driver.execute_script(r#" let m = space.getScreenCTM();